Montenegro: We’re too small to start a new world war

…US President Donald Trump suggested this week that this tiny Balkan country could be the crucible for a new global conflict.

Montenegro begs to differ.

“We have no intentions whatsoever to start World War III, we are too small for that,” the country’s foreign minister, Srdjan Darmanovic, told CNN in an exclusive interview. “It was fun to hear about it, actually like a good joke, but we are a very peaceful nation.”

…The newest NATO member was thrown into the spotlight when Trump described its people as “very aggressive.”

…Carlson questioned why the US should have to defend Montenegro, as required by Article 5 of the NATO treaty.

Trump responded: “I’ve asked the same question. Montenegro is a tiny country with very strong people. … They are very strong people. They are very aggressive people, they may get aggressive, and congratulations, you are in World War III.”

…Montenegro joined NATO in 2017. Its membership bid was opposed by Russia, which maintains close relationships with neighboring Serbia. The Montenegrin government accuses Moscow of orchestrating a coup as part of an effort to prevent it joining NATO.

U.S. gathering on religious freedom sets up competing narratives

The gathering gives Trump a high-wattage spotlight for showing his pro-Christian bona fides to the evangelical voters who helped him win the Oval Office. But it also gives the president’s critics a platform to assail what they see as his hypocrisy on human rights, especially when it comes to Muslims, whom Trump once proposed banning from U.S. soil.

…According to a State Department staffer, countries that managed to snag seats include Bahrain and Hungary, whose governments have been accused of hostility toward some religious groups. In Bahrain, Shiite Muslims, many of whom are opposition activists, have faced crackdowns by the Sunni-led monarchy. Hungary’s increasingly autocratic ruling party has faced a backlash over a law stripping recognition from a range of religious groups.

…The State Department staffer said that Russia and Turkey, whose religious-rights records have been increasingly problematic, were left off the invite list. The staffer added that administration officials hoped to highlight in particular the religious abuses by the government of Iran, an Islamist-led country that the Trump administration has singled out for pressure to the point where analysts say it is effectively aiming for regime change.

On the civil-society front, the administration is taking an inclusive approach: Invitees range from atheists to Scientologists, according to the State Department staffer. Representatives of more broad-based organizations, such as Human Rights Watch, are also on the list. Many are hosting side events.

Oldest Greek Fragment of Homer Discovered on Clay Tablet

The epics of the Greek poet Homer, The Iliad and The Odyssey, have been recited around campfires and scrutinized by students for 2,800 years, if not longer. 

…It’s believed that The Odyssey and The Iliad come from an oral storytelling tradition. Whether the stories were composed by a blind poet named Homer is a source of debate, though many researchers believe Homer was probably not a historical individual but a cultural tradition that developed the stories over many decades or centuries, with scribes writing them down sometime around the 8th century B.C.

Body of ‘witch’ tormented by villagers 1,600 years ago found buried with one-hand tied behind back

The woman was found face down with her left hand fixed behind her back – a position hat was apparently used in witch burials to ensure that they do not return from the dead and haunt the villagers.

It is thought that she was the lover of a wealthy man, who would have blamed her ‘magic powers’ as the reason behind his adultery. This accusation would have been the cause of her torture by the villagers.

…Most women accused of witchcraft tended to be older yet occasionally young women found themselves accused of witchcraft, usually if they ended up in relationships with the wrong man or even if they had been sexually abused by a man of influence.

…This woman lived in times of the Chernyakhov culture. Her grave differs from burial traditions that existed in this area in the third and fourth centuries AD.”

The Chernyakhov culture is an archaeological culture that flourished between the 2nd and 5th centuries AD in a wide area of Eastern Europe, specifically in what is now Ukraine, Romania, Moldova and parts of Belarus.

Castro proposes changes to Constitution, including term limits for president, gay marriage

Raúl Castro is proposing a new constitution that would limit the age of future presidents to 60 at the start of their first terms.

The constitutional reforms, discussed Saturday by the Cuban parliament, also would erase the word “Communism” from the document and open the way for same-sex marriage, according to official TV broadcasts of the gathering.

…The official web page Cubadebate also reported Saturday that the new constitution would define marriage as “the consensual union between two people, regardless of gender.” That’s been one of the demands by LGBTI groups on the island and Raúl Castro’s daughter, Mariela, who heads a sex education center in Havana.

…The president will continue to be elected by parliament and not directly by voters — a change that many Cubans wanted.

And the new constitution will recognize private property but “retains the essential principles of socialist ownership by the people over the basic means of production and central planning as a principal component,” according to the official Granma newspaper.

Syrian refugees cling to life on Golan Heights as Assad’s net tightens

The displaced are trapped at the edges of this corner of Syria, where three countries meet. Jordan, to the south, says it already hosts more than a million displaced people and cannot accommodate any more. Israel, too, has said it will not allow any refugees to cross, despite urgent calls by humanitarian agencies saying their safety is at risk. Part of its refusal is an unwillingness to tip a demographic balance in a majority Jewish state, where about a fifth of the population is Arab.

…Israel’s annexation of the Golan Heights was not recognised internationally and it remains in a state of war with Syria, meaning Syrians who seek Israeli treatment are at risk when they go back. Ziv hospital makes sure not to identify them, and discharge papers are written in Arabic and English, with no visible Hebrew.

Ivanka Trump to shut down fashion company

Ivanka Trump’s company saw an increase in profits in early 2017 after her father’s presidential win, according to a person with direct knowledge. But since that gain, profits have declined, the source added.

…Nordstrom isn’t the only retailer to distance itself from the brand.

The company that owns TJ Maxx and Marshalls decided to no longer promote the brand in stores, and earlier this month, Hudson’s Bay, one of Canada’s largest department stores, chose to phase out Ivanka Trump products, according to company spokeswoman Tiffany Bourré.

…The government watchdog group Citizens for Responsibility and Ethics in Washington called the news that Ivanka Trump will be shutting down her company “a notable step in the right direction,” but added that it “comes much too late.”

…Ivanka is expected to address her company’s staff on Tuesday in New York, according to a source with knowledge of her decision-making process. The same source said 18 people will be affected by the company shutting down.

Albany Home Depot employee turns down offer for old job

Social media exploded over the weekend with the story about the Albany man who was fired from the Home Depot on Central Avenue because he didn’t seek a manager’s help in dealing with a customer’s racist rant.

Home Depot has since offered Maurice Rucker his old job back. His response — thanks but no thanks. In his own words, Rucker does not feel comfortable putting on the orange apron again.

…Rucker didn’t hear from the individual store. Instead, he heard from the corporate office in Atlanta.

“‘We want you back.’ It’s like, no, you want this to stop. That’s what you want,” said Rucker.
